The materials for computer gong machining are usually free cutting steel and copper. The free cutting steel has higher sulfur content and phosphorus content. Sulfur and manganese exist in the steel in the form of manganese sulfide. Manganese sulfide plays a lubricating role in the steel, making the steel easier to cut, thus improving the production progress of lathe bed. So what should be paid attention to when CNC lathe processing?

  1. When aligning the workpiece, it is only allowed to move the chuck by hand or turn on the lowest speed for alignment, and do not turn on the high speed for alignment.
  2. When changing the rotation direction of the spindle, the spindle should be stopped first and then. It is not allowed to change the rotation direction suddenly.
  3. When loading and unloading the chuck, only rotate the V-belt manually to drive the spindle to rotate. It is absolutely forbidden to directly start the machine tool and force it to loosen or tighten. At the same time, a board should be placed on the bed to prevent accidents.
  4. The tool installation should not extend too long, the gasket should be flat and straight, and the width should be consistent with the width of the tool bottom surface.

In order to set the knife conveniently, the imaginary point P is often used to set the knife. If there is no tool tip radius compensation, undercut will occur when turning cone or arc. When the accuracy of the part is high and there is a cone or arc, the solution is to calculate the trajectory size of the tool tip arc center, and then compile and calculate the local compensation.

Is the tool position compensation caused by the radius r of tool tip arc when turning dimensional surface. When the tool position compensation is carried out in Z and X directions at the same time, the actual contact point a between the cutting edge and the workpiece moves to the set point P of the tool tip during programming. The compensation amount of R can be calculated by the following formula: when programming the conical surface of the workpiece, the base point coordinates are the coordinates of the base point of the workpiece contour (Z and x) plus the compensation amount of the radius of the tool tip arc R (DZ and DX), thus solving the problem that there is no compensation for the radius of the tool tip arc Questions. Because there is an arc at the tool tip, the workpiece contour is formed by the tool motion envelope, so the motion path of the tool location does not coincide with the contour of the workpiece. In the full function CNC system, the tool compensation instruction can be used to program conveniently according to the contour size of the workpiece. In the economical CNC system, the path of the cutter location can be calculated according to the contour size of the workpiece and the cutter. According to this programming, it can also be solved by the method of local compensation.

In order to improve the work efficiency and reduce the errors of various operations, the safe operation that should be paid attention to in the process of C is summarized as follows:

  1. Try to install the clamping material first and then the cutting tool to prevent the hand from touching the tool when installing the clamping material. If the tool has been installed, the worktable should first be moved to the outside to ensure that the clamping material will not interfere with the tool, so as to avoid injury or breakage of the tool.
  2. After stopping, it is necessary to observe whether the spindle stops rotating when disassembling the tool.
  3. Don’t hold or pinch the edge of the knife when unloading it to avoid scratching.
  4. In the process of machining mechanical parts, operators are not allowed to observe the cutting position closely to prevent chips from falling into eyes.
  5. The wrench should be placed in the tool storage area after use, not on the y-axis shield or beam.
  6. Before CNC machining, check the position of the oil nozzle before opening the oil pump switch to avoid spraying to other positions when flushing oil.
  7. When suspending observation during machining clearance, the worktable must be moved away from the cutting position.
  8. Inspection. After processing, before disassembling the workpiece, it is necessary to conduct preliminary inspection on the size or appearance of the workpiece. The workpiece can only be disassembled after passing the inspection, so as to avoid positioning problems of secondary processing and scrapping of the workpiece after disassembly. For some key dimension data of the disassembled workpiece, further inspection is needed to meet the requirements.
